我想将1234010
变成1.2M
在rails中我会number_to_human( 1234010 )
,是否有一个angularjs过滤器是等价的还是我需要自己滚动?
此外,是否有地方可以看到过滤器内置的所有angularjs?
答案 0 :(得分:3)
您可以引入像Humanize+这样的库并创建自己的过滤器......
angular.module('app', [])
.filter('numberToHuman', function() {
return function(num, precision) {
return Humanize.compactInteger(num, precision);
};
});
<div ng-app="app">
{{ 1234010 | numberToHuman: 1 }}
</div>